Less than 2 weeks away! The ever popular (and always sold out) Arcadia Film Festival is Monday, May 14, 6:15 PM at the Harkins Shea 14 Theaters (Scottsdale Road/Shea). Reserved Seats ($20 each) are available for purchase at the Arcadia Book Store only until THIS FRIDAY. Tickets will be available at the door (first come, first serve until theater sells out) - $8 for students, $10 for adults. The students will be selling raffle tickets at the Film Festival for the chance to win many great items: Johnjay & Rich Backstage Pass, Diamondbacks Tickets, SNEAKY BIG Studios Behind The Scenes Tour, LaLaLand album from Emma Stone, Arcadia Ice Arena party, equipment services/rental, Pilates & Yoga classes, jewelry, clothing, dog grooming, gift cards of all types, and much more. Raffle tickets will cost $5 each or $20 for 5 tickets.
The Film Festival is the biggest fundraiser of the year for the award-winning Arcadia Media Comm Program. Funds are being raised to purchase critically needed new film and television equipment which will benefit all Arcadia students, faculty and administration.
